Hammer Action (Weak-Side Baseline Pin)

A hammer action is an off-ball play where, as a teammate drives the baseline, a weak-side player sets a baseline back/flare screen ("hammer") for a corner shooter, freeing them for a skip pass and a wide-open corner three.
